Ruel’s highly anticipated third EP will drop next month, with the Aussie artist today teasing a new single from it.

Bright Lights, Red Eyes will drop on October 23 via RCA Records/Sony Music Entertainment Australia and was written entirely in Paris.

"I want to get across that this project is another step forward in maturity for me,” Ruel said.

Free Time was a step up from Ready, and this Bright Lights, Red Eyes EP is a step up again. This project was a stream of consciousness when I was writing it at the time, and I feel like that’s the way all projects and songs are for me. They are moments in time. 

“This project isn’t who I am right now, as I wrote these songs last year, but it’s the most mature you’ve ever heard me and it was me, in that moment in time. The songs I’m writing now will be more mature again, and I love that my fans can come on this journey with me as I grow.”
